Glenfiddich

Brand info:

GlenfiddichLogo

Glenfiddich was build in 1886 by William Grant, a former manager at Mortlach distillery.

The first spirit was distilled on Christmas Day 1887.

In 1963 Glenfiddich was the first distillery to start marketing their whisky as single malt.

It is still owned by the Grant family, which also owns Balvenie, Kininvie, Ailsa Bay and Girvan grain distillery.
